17 Words That Start With MARI

Part of Speech:
Word Definitions Synonyms
maria (noun) a dark region of considerable extent on the surface of the moon Synonyms: mare
mariachi (noun) a group of street musicians in Mexico
marigold (noun) any of various tropical American plants of the genus Tagetes widely cultivated for their showy yellow or orange flowers
marihuana (noun) the most commonly used illicit drug; considered a soft drug, it consists of the dried leaves of the hemp plant; smoked or chewed for euphoric effect Synonyms: cannabis, ganja, marijuana
(noun) a strong-smelling plant whose dried leaves can be smoked for a pleasant effect or pain reduction Synonyms: Cannabis sativa, ganja, marijuana
marijuana (noun) the most commonly used illicit drug; considered a soft drug, it consists of the dried leaves of the hemp plant; smoked or chewed for euphoric effect Synonyms: cannabis, ganja, marihuana
(noun) a strong-smelling plant whose dried leaves can be smoked for a pleasant effect or pain reduction Synonyms: Cannabis sativa, ganja, marihuana
marimba (noun) a percussion instrument with wooden bars tuned to produce a chromatic scale and with resonators; played with small mallets Synonyms: xylophone
marina (noun) a fancy dock for small yachts and cabin cruisers
marinade (noun) mixtures of vinegar or wine and oil with various spices and seasonings; used for soaking foods before cooking
(verb) soak in marinade Synonyms: marinate
marinara (noun) sauce for pasta; contains tomatoes and garlic and herbs
marinate (verb) soak in marinade Synonyms: marinade
marine (adjective) relating to or characteristic of or occurring on or in the sea
(adjective) of or relating to the sea
(adjective) of or relating to military personnel who serve both on land and at sea (specifically the U.S. Marine Corps)
(adjective) relating to or involving ships or shipping or navigation or seamen Synonyms: maritime, nautical
(adjective) native to or inhabiting the sea
(noun) a soldier who serves both on shipboard and on land
mariner (noun) a man who serves as a sailor Synonyms: gob, Jack-tar, Jack, old salt, sea dog, seafarer, seaman, tar
marionette (noun) a small figure of a person operated from above with strings by a puppeteer Synonyms: puppet
mariposa (noun) any of several plants of the genus Calochortus having tulip-shaped flowers with 3 sepals and 3 petals; southwestern United States and Mexico Synonyms: mariposa lily, mariposa tulip
marital (adjective) of or relating to the state of marriage Synonyms: married, matrimonial
mariticide (noun) the murder of a husband by his wife
maritime (adjective) relating to or involving ships or shipping or navigation or seamen Synonyms: marine, nautical
(adjective) bordering on or living or characteristic of those near the sea
